Actuated Butterfly Valves: Engineering Grace Meets Automation

Actuated butterfly valves merge sleek, compact architecture with powerful actuation—pneumatic, electric, or hydraulic—yielding precise control over large volumes of media. Their ability to turn a simple control signal into swift mechanical action, completing a 90-degree turn to open or close flow, delivers exceptional adaptability, energy efficiency, and safety. High-grade butterfly valves, especially those with UL approval, have proven indispensable in water treatment and fire suppression thanks to their outstanding corrosion resistance and operational reliability.

Motor Operated Valves (MOVs): Precision and Remote Command

Motor operated valves combine robust mechanical design with advanced electrical actuation, enabling absolute control—often remotely—over flow in pipelines and processing systems. Not only do these valves support on-off or modulating service, but their resistance to extreme temperatures, pressures, and hazardous environments makes them vital to oil & gas, power, and chemical plants. Their integration with digital control systems reduces operator risk and ensures flawless performance in mission-critical scenarios.

Rubber Lined Valves: Maximum Protection for Challenging Flows

These meticulously designed valves feature resilient elastomeric linings, shielding internal passageways from corrosion, abrasion, and aggressive media. The result: longer valve life, guaranteed purity in sensitive processes, and reliable control through the most erosive and chemically aggressive conditions. Application Spectrum: Across Indian Industry and Beyond

Valves are central to the smooth operation of nearly every major industrial segment:

  • Oil & Gas: Gate and ball valves control the vast networks transporting hydrocarbons from wellhead to refinery.
  • Power Generation: Safety relief and MOVs regulate high-pressure steam and cooling systems in thermal and nuclear plants.
  • Water & Wastewater: Butterfly and check valves enable efficient water treatment, supply, and recycling.
  • Chemicals & Pharmaceuticals: Regulated, contamination-free flow is ensured by high-precision globe and diaphragm valves.
  • Mining & Metals: Rubber lined valves resist aggressive slurries and acidic environments.
  • Food & Beverage: Hygienic valves secure product integrity and operational cleanliness.
